In a significant breakthrough, Puducherry police arrested two individuals involved in smuggling banned tobacco products. The operation led to the seizure of 146 kg of illicit items, marking a major success in the fight against the illegal tobacco trade.

Police acted on a tip-off, conducting a raid that uncovered the contraband. The accused were caught red-handed while transporting the products. Authorities emphasized that such items not only violate laws but also pose serious health risks to the public.

This operation is part of a broader crackdown on the illegal tobacco trade, aimed at protecting public health and ensuring compliance with regulations. Police have urged citizens to report suspicious activities to aid in curbing such crimes.
